Wax Candles

These days candles are made from paraffin wax. 400 years ago they were made from bees wax. Bees make wax honeycombsto keep their honey in. Honey combs are lots of joined hexagonal shapes.

 

The honey was removed from the comb. The wax could be flattened and wound around a wick to make a candle. Or it could be melted and poured into a candle shaped mould. The wicks hung down from a board in the centre so they would be inside the candle when the wax went hard.

Beeswax candles were expensive. Even very rich people did not use them everyday.
